The Coffs Harbour Garden Club is a community organisation run by a team of gardening enthusiasts from the NSW mid-north Coast.
The roots of the Garden Club reach back in our local history to the Horticultural Society which started in October 1950. Throughout both the histories of the Horticultural Society and the Coffs Harbour Garden Club there has always been committed support towards community projects and organisations. The development of the North Coast Regional Botanic Garden was one such major undertaking.
Each year the club conducts our premier annual event, the Spring Garden Competition; participate in Clean up Australia Day; our members maintain the air-side gardens at the Coffs Regional Airport; and conduct the horticulture competitions at the Coffs Show.
Our Club activities include guest speakers; trading table; competition table; and monthly outings.
We meet every third Saturday of the month Jan-Nov at the Botanic Garden Display Room, Hardacre Street, Coffs Harbour, commencing at 1.30pm unless otherwise mentioned (depending on availability of meeting venue).
